In an experiment on photoelectric effect, stopping potential is 1.0V when light of wavelength 6520A˚ is incident on the emitting surface. The stopping potential is 2.9V for light of wavelength 3260A˚. The work function of the metal is

Solution:
λhc=W+eVs 652nmhc=W+1eV
Also, 326nmhc=W+2.9eV
Equating hc from both the equations 652(W+1)=326(W+2.9) 2(W+1)=W+2.9 W=2.9−2 W=0.9eV
